How do I calculate IPLV?

Integrated Part Load Value (IPLV) : Hence to calculate the exact performance value considering different loading conditions, IPLV is used. IPLV Formula = 0.01A+0.42B+0.45C+0.12D; where A,B,C&D are the COP values at 4 loading points respectively.

What is IPLV in refrigeration?

The Integrated Part Load Value (IPLV) is a performance characteristic developed by the Air-Conditioning, Heating and Refrigeration Institute (AHRI). It is most commonly used to describe the performance of a chiller capable of capacity modulation.

What is a SEER?

First, the basics. SEER stands for Seasonal Energy Efficiency Ratio. This is the ratio of the cooling output of an air conditioner over a typical cooling season, divided by the energy it uses in Watt-Hours. Keep in mind that SEER ratio is a maximum efficiency rating, like the miles per gallon for your car.

What is COP value?

Coefficient of Performance The COP is determined by the ratio between energy usage of the compressor and the amount of useful cooling at the evaporator (for a refrigeration instalation) or useful heat extracted from the condensor (for a heat pump). A high COP value represents a high efficiency.

What is iplv and how is it calculated?

The IPLV is calculated on the weighted percentage of assumed operational hours at each operating condition. So there are four operating points that are going to be measured. This is an average efficiency of a single chiller. A lot of chiller installations will have multiple chillers. So this is a rating for a single chiller.

What is the difference between cop and iplv?

Unlike an EER (Energy Efficiency Ratio) or COP (coefficient of performance), which describes the efficiency at full load conditions, the IPLV is derived from the equipment efficiency while operating at various capacities.
